Rituals Braintree Village
Opening hours
Please check our most up to date opening hours via Google Maps.
Braintree Village
UNIT G5B, BRAINTREE VILLAGE, CHARTER WAY, CHAPEL HILL, BRAINTREE, ESSEX, CM77 8YH
CM77 8YH Braintree
Can’t wait?
Shop your favourite Rituals products online.